Liquid phase hydroxylation of benzene over Cu-containing ternary hydrotalcites

One step liquid phase hydroxylation of benzene to phenol over ternary hydrotalcites of general formula CuM(II)M(III)-HT, where M(II) = Mg, Co, Ni and Zn and M(III) = Al, Fe and Cr was carried out in the temperature range 30-80 degrees C using pyridine as solvent and H2O, as oxidant. Influence of various reaction parameters, such as reaction temperature, substrate: catalyst ratio, substrate weight, volume of the solvent, calcination temperature and reaction time were studied. Among the catalysts screened, CuCoAl-HT and CuNiAl-HT with (Cu + Co(or Ni))/Al = 3.0 and Cu/Co(or Ni) = 3.0 showed maximum activity with nearly 100% selectivity of phenol. The hydroxyl radical generated upon interaction of catalyst with oxidant is believed to be the active species involved in this reaction. (c) 2005 Elsevier B.V. All rights reserved.
